Exclusive sneak peek: Kochadaiiyaan songs

"Appa, I'm going for an audio listening session," Soundarya told her dad, Superstar Rajinikanth, on Thursday morning. She was referring to an event organized by Sony Music in Chennai to preview the songs exclusively to some select members of the press. Rajini was quite interested in the concept, which showcased four songs from the film that has music by Oscar winner AR Rahman. A preview of the songs screened:

Mannapenin Sathiyam, sung by Latha Rajinikanth, revolves around a wedding situation in the film. The song is about the promise of a husband to his wife and vice versa. Says Soundarya, "Every time I listen to this particular song, I'm in tears. It's emotional because it is my amma (Latha) singing for my appa (Rajinikanth)."

Medhuvaagathan by SPB and Sadhana Sargam is a melody duet. It has a lot of commercial element and is said to be the 'commercial song' in the period drama.
